A church father on this verse
From this we see what it means to say that the mystery was concealed in God, for he adds "according to the purpose of the ages." This means that, after certain ages had reached their destined end, the mystery was to appear through the presence of the Lord in whom it had been concealed. For it was proper for it to be r…
Gaius Marius Victorinus, 4th c. — EPISTLE TO THE EPHESIANS 1.3.11

In context

9And to make all men see what is the fellowship of the mystery, which from the beginning of the world hath been hid in God, who created all things by Jesus Christ:

10To the intent that now unto the principalities and powers in heavenly places might be known by the church the manifold wisdom of God,

Ephesians 3:11

12In whom we have boldness and access with confidence by the faith of him.

13Wherefore I desire that ye faint not at my tribulations for you, which is your glory.
